Reedy, WV Facts, Population, Income, Demographics, Economy

Population (total): Population in 2019: 161 (0% urban, 100% rural). >Population change since 2000: -18.7%

Population (male): 75

Population (female): 86

Median Age: 43.2 years

Median Rent: Median gross rent in 2019: $672.

Cost of Living: March 2019 cost of living index in Reedy: 83.3 (low, U.S. average is 100)

Poverty (overall): Percentage of residents living in poverty in 2019: 42.3%

Poverty (breakdown): (30.3% for White Non-Hispanic residents, 100.0% for Hispanic or Latino residents)

Sex Offenders: According to our research of West Virginia and other state lists, there were 4 registered sex offenders living in Reedy, West Virginia as of April 25, 2021. The ratio of all residents to sex offenders in Reedy is 31 to 1.>

Ancestries: Ancestries: American (64.4%), English (6.7%), French (4.4%), Irish (2.2%), Italian (2.2%).

Elevation: 678 feet

Land Area: 0.22 square miles.

Workplace Drug Testing in Reedy, West Virginia

Employers are encouraged to develop workplace drug testing programs which are designed to detect the presence of alcohol, illicit street drugs or specific prescription drugs in Reedy.

Employers will see the following benefits of being a Reedy, WV Drug Free Workplace:

  • Enhanced Employee Performance
  • Reduced Job-Related Accidents
  • Reduced Employee Absenteeism
  • Lower Workers Compensation Rates
  • Improved Employee Moral
  • Improved Customer Satisfaction

In addition, many companies, including Reedy, regardless of size indicate that becoming a Drug Free Workplace has increased the quality of job applicants and improved the overall workplace environment.

DOT Drug Testing in Reedy, WV

If you employ DOT designated safety sensitive employees who are required to have a Department of Transportation Drug and Alcohol Test (FMCSA, USCG, FAA, FTA, FRA, PHMSA) or if you manage a DOT drug or alcohol testing program for a company, it is imperative that you understand and comply with the requirements of 49 CFR Part 40 DOT drug and alcohol testing regulations.
